Abstract :
In order to solve the condition that E-Commerce is inefficient and relies largely on labor, a B2B E-Commerce Model (MAECS) based on the Multi-agent system (MAS) was introduced. This system focused on distributed FIPA-Agent OS based multi-agent system, and introduced the facilitator such as buyer agent and seller agent. This system reduced communication traffic effectively, realized the asynchronous transfer of information and platform-independent, making e-commerce system handle the business processes independently and intelligently and improved e-commerce activities efficiency.
